Aldi has announced further price cuts for many of its products from this week. The budget supermarket chain said that nearly 50 products will see prices fall by an average of seven per cent.

Items affected include many staples such as cheese, butter, poultry as well as household essentials such as cleaning products.

It comes after the chain slashed the proce of more than 200 products over the past few months in a bid to help customers through the cost of living crisis.

Julie Ashfield, Managing Director of Buying at Aldi UK, highlighted that the company "promises" to keep prices as low as possible.
